Adama Soumaoro hanging out by the Lille exit door; strong German interest

L’Équipe report that Lille vice-captain Adama Soumaoro is likely heading towards the exit door next month, owing to his lack of playing time so far this season.

Having supposedly failed a medical with Monaco in summer after carrying a long-term knock, the Principality side may return for his services next month.

The central defender also has considerable interest from German clubs, even though he would prefer a Premier League adventure. Two years ago, LOSC rejected a €20m bid from Crystal Palace for the player.

Now, they would be willing to sell for between €13m – €15m.
